aggettivo
- 1
Resembling a freak.
- 2
gergoOdd; bizarre; unusual.
I've heard the props and costumes in this play are quite freaky.
- 3
gergoScary; frightening.
Have you met the freaky new guy who moved in next door?
- 4
gergoSexually deviant or overly sexual.
The things she asked me to do were too freaky for me.
GCN was prevented from covering the hearing by a police officer outside the building, who said that he would not allow representatives of "freaky" press inside.
- 5
gergoSexually deviant or overly sexual. Sexually aroused, horny.
